Early Career & Górnik Zabrze

Gryszkiewicz began his footballing education in his native Poland. He joined the youth academy of Górnik Zabrze, a club with a significant history in Polish football. It was at Górnik Zabrze where he honed his skills as a defender, rising through their youth setup. His performances earned him a call-up to the senior squad, and he made his debut for the club. He spent several seasons with Górnik Zabrze, gaining valuable experience in the Ekstraklasa, Poland's top flight. During his tenure, he became a regular feature in the team's defense, contributing to their league campaigns and cup competitions. Subsequent Club Moves

Following his spell at Górnik Zabrze, Gryszkiewicz sought new challenges to further his career. In 2022, he moved to SC Paderborn 07 in Germany, joining the 2. Bundesliga side. This move represented a significant step, exposing him to a different footballing culture and a highly competitive league. Youth National Teams

Gryszkiewicz's most notable international involvement came with the Poland U20 team. He was part of the squad that participated in the FIFA U-20 World Cup in 2019, which was hosted by Poland. This tournament provided him with an opportunity to compete against some of the brightest young talents from around the globe.
